The first International Intersex Forum is held.

Date: 2011

This gathering brings together 24 people from 17 organizations from around the world. Participants agree on three shared demands, which will organize their work in the years to come. They are as follows: "1) To put an end to mutilating and ‘normalising’ practices such as genital surgeries, psychological and other medical treatments, including infanticide and selective abortion (on the grounds of intersex) in some parts of the world. 2) To insure [sic] that the personal, free, prior, and fully informed consent of the intersex individual is a compulsory requirement in all medical practices and protocols. 3) Creating and facilitating supportive, safe and celebratory environments for intersex people, their families and surroundings" (IGLYO, 2011).
